Stroopwafel — Caramel Syrup Waffles
Thin, crispy Dutch waffles filled with warm caramel syrup — a viral TikTok treat that's less fussy than it sounds. Toast them if you have a waffle iron, or fry thin in a skillet and sandwich with homemade caramel.
- Total time
- 25 min
- Servings
- 4
- Calories
- 385
- Protein
- 4g

Ingredients
- 1.25 cups all-purpose flour
- 5 tbsp unsalted butter, melted
- 3 tbsp granulated sugar
- 1 whole eggs
- ¾ cup caramel or dulce de leche
- ¼ tsp sea salt
Instructions
- 1
Whisk flour, sugar, and sea salt together in a bowl.
- 2
Add egg and melted butter, stir until a smooth, thick batter forms.
- 3
Heat waffle iron (or 10-inch nonstick skillet over medium-high). Lightly butter the surface.
- 4
Pour 2–3 tbsp batter into waffle iron (or skillet), close lid and cook until golden and crispy, about 2–3 minutes per side.
- 5
Warm caramel in a small saucepan over low heat or microwave 30 seconds until pourable.
- 6
Spread 1 tbsp warm caramel on top of one waffle, sandwich with a second waffle. Serve immediately while caramel is still melting.
Tools you’ll need
- waffle iron (or 10-inch nonstick skillet)
- mixing bowl
- whisk
- small saucepan (or microwave-safe bowl)
- spatula
